Economic Policies and Manufacturing Revitalization in the U.S.

The chapter explores the contrasting economic policies of recent U.S. presidents, focusing on tariffs and manufacturing strategies. It highlights Trump's trade agreements, Obama's renewable energy initiatives, and Biden's legislation to enhance high-tech manufacturing, examining their impacts on American employment.
